- Provenance
- Sir Joshua Reynolds (1723-1792), London [stamp (2364), recto, lower right, in black]. Arthur Melville Champernowne (1871–1946), Dartington Hall, Totnes, Devon [inscription (Lugt 153), recto, lower right, in black]. William F. E. Gurley (1854–1943), Chicago [stamp (Lugt 5308) recto, lower right, in black]; given to the Art Institute of Chicago for the Leonora Hall Gurley Memorial Collection, 1922.
